These two ballets reveal a specific facet of Stravinsky’s genius, his skill in pastiche. Having used music from eighteenth-century Naples for Pulcinella, he turned to Tchaikovsky for Le Baiser de la fée.
On both occasions, he succeeded in transforming the exercise of homage into a highly personal work.
Stravinsky had a special artistic affinity with the Toronto Symphony Orchestra, which amply repays the debt with this new recording.
